Hugh, who held the manor of William de Ow in 1086, was Hugh Maltravers, ancestor of the Maltravers of Lytchett (co. Dors.). In 1256 his descendant John Maltravers sued his tenant Robert de Stutescombe for suit due for the manor at John's court at Lytchett. John was holding this mesne lordship in 1275–6, and was succeeded in 1296 by his son John. This mesne lordship is again mentioned in 1331, but seems to have lapsed after this time, and in 1387 Charlton was held immediately of the Earl of Stafford.
